POWER UP PRESENTS… GET UP, STAND UP!

This thought leadership panel explores the progress – or lack of – on race accountability in the music industry since the 2020 BLM protest movement. We’ll also explore what it means to be ethical, how to take a stand and the greater challenges facing Black artists in 2024.

JACQUELINE SPRINGER IN CONVERSATION WITH BERWYN POWERED BY V&A EAST

Expect a deep dive as Jacqueline Springer explores the life and times of BERWYN, Trinidad-born, Romford-raised rapper, singer, songwriter, producer and two-time Mercury Music Prize nominee.

ud live showcase – powered by trench

UD’s Incubator Programme is a talent and career development opportunity for exceptional independent artists, making music of Black origin. Join us at this exclusive Incubator 2024 Showcase, where you’re invited to witness the stars of tomorrow, today. Expect R&B, soul, rap and more in-between.
